Understanding the Role of a Tube Fitter
Before diving into the specifics, let's briefly explore the role of a tube fitter. Tube fitters are skilled professionals responsible for installing, maintaining, and repairing systems that transport fluids or gases through tubes. This role requires meticulous attention to detail, a strong understanding of safety standards, and the ability to work with various materials and tools.
The Do's of Tube Fitting
1. Do Use the Right Tools and Equipment
The selection of appropriate tools is crucial for maximizing efficiency in tube fitting. Always ensure you have the right tools for cutting, bending, and installing tubes. This reduces the chances of errors and enhances the quality of your work.
2. Do Stick to Safety Standards
Safety should be the foremost concern for any tube fitter. Adhering to industry safety standards not only protects you but also ensures the durability and reliability of the system you are working on. Familiarize yourself with all relevant guidelines and incorporate them into your daily routines.
3. Do Plan Your Work Thoroughly
Effective planning is a cornerstone of efficient tube fitting. Before starting any project, assess the requirements, gather necessary materials, and chart out your steps. This reduces downtime and streamlines the fitting process.
4. Do Maintain Clear Communication
Whether working individually or as part of a team, maintaining clear communication is vital. This ensures everyone is on the same page and minimizes misunderstandings that could lead to costly mistakes or delays.
5. Do Conduct Regular Inspections
Regular inspections of your work and equipment help catch potential issues before they escalate. This proactive approach helps maintain the integrity of the entire system and saves time and resources in the long term.
The Don'ts of Tube Fitting
1. Don’t Overlook Custom Measurements
A one-size-fits-all approach is inappropriate for tube fitting. Each installation can require custom measurements; overlooking these could lead to improper fits and system failures. Always double-check your measurements before committing to installation.
2. Don’t Rush the Process
Efficiency is not synonymous with speed. Rushing through projects can lead to critical errors. Take the time needed to complete each step correctly, ensuring quality is maintained throughout.
3. Don’t Neglect Proper Training
Tube fitting requires a specific skill set, and ongoing training is essential to keep these skills sharp. Don't neglect opportunities for further education, as keeping up with industry developments and techniques can greatly enhance your efficiency.
4. Don’t Ignore Equipment Upkeep
Regular maintenance of your tools and equipment is necessary for efficiency. Neglecting upkeep can result in equipment failure, which halts progress and creates additional costs.
5. Don’t Disregard the Environmental Impact
Be mindful of the materials and processes you use in tube fitting. Considering the environmental impact can guide you towards more sustainable and efficient practices.
